新聞中心
以下的文章主要介紹的是MySQL 操作日志查看的實際操作步驟以及對其實際操作步驟的具體描述,假如你在實際操作中遇到相似的情況,但是你卻不知道對其如何正確的解決,那么以下的文章對你而言一定是良師益友。

創(chuàng)新互聯(lián)公司專注于網(wǎng)站建設(shè),為客戶提供成都網(wǎng)站設(shè)計、成都網(wǎng)站建設(shè)、網(wǎng)頁設(shè)計開發(fā)服務,多年建網(wǎng)站服務經(jīng)驗,各類網(wǎng)站都可以開發(fā),品牌網(wǎng)站制作,公司官網(wǎng),公司展示網(wǎng)站,網(wǎng)站設(shè)計,建網(wǎng)站費用,建網(wǎng)站多少錢,價格優(yōu)惠,收費合理。
剛接觸MySQL不久,發(fā)現(xiàn)缺少比較多企業(yè)級的功能,想實時查看MySQL所執(zhí)行的sql語句,類似mssql里的事件探查器,上網(wǎng)找了一下,只能將執(zhí)行操作寫到日志里,做法如下:
對my.ini文件進行設(shè)置,我的MySQL安裝環(huán)境是xp sp2,該文件在c:\windows\..下,打開文件進行修改
- [MySQLd]
- basedir=E:/MySQL 4.0.12
- #bind-address=192.168.15.196
- datadir=E:/MySQL 4.0.12/data
- #language=E:/MySQL 4.0.12/share/your language directory
- #slow query log#=slowqueris.log
- #tmpdir#=
- #port=3306
- #set-variable=key_buffer=16M
long_query_time =1 --是指執(zhí)行超過多久的sql會被log下來,這里是1秒
log-slow-queries=slowqueris.log --將查詢返回較慢的語句進行記錄
log-queries-not-using-indexes = nouseindex.log --就是字面意思,log下來沒有使用索引的query
log=mylog.log --對所有執(zhí)行語句進行記錄
以上參數(shù)開啟后,可能會影響MySQL性能,在生產(chǎn)環(huán)境下建議關(guān)閉
【編輯推薦】
- MySQL使用備忘的實際操作步驟概述
- MySQL 免安裝版的實際配置方法
- MySQL基本語法的列舉
- 找回MySQL root密碼的解決方案
- MySQL數(shù)據(jù)庫備份的命令實際應用
本文題目:MySQL 操作日志查看的實際操作步驟與代碼
分享鏈接:http://fisionsoft.com.cn/article/dpgdgig.html


咨詢
建站咨詢
